I love this lighthouse and I particularly love it from the ocean side. You can see why there is a lighthouse at this location. The rocky shoreline is a boaters worst nightmare. The fog is sometimes very dense and the rocky shore would not be visible in the slightest. The loud fog horn and iridescent red light saved and will continue to save many ships and boats during inclement weather.
